MySQL是一种开源的关系型数据库管理系统,被广泛应用于各种应用程序的数据存储和管理。在使用MySQL时,大家经常需要考虑如何优化数据库的性能,以提高系统的响应速度和处理能力。其中一个重要的因素是MySQL表的列数,它对数据库的性能有着不可忽视的影响。
首先,MySQL表的列数会影响磁盘空间的占用。每个表的每个列都需要占用一定的磁盘空间,而随着列数的增加,表的总磁盘空间也会增加。这会导致磁盘的使用率上升,可能会影响系统的性能。应该尽量减少不必要的列,避免浪费磁盘空间。
其次,MySQL表的列数也会影响查询的性能。查询是MySQL最常用的操作之一,而查询的效率与表的列数密切相关。当表的列数很多时,查询所需的时间也会相应增加。这是因为MySQL需要扫描更多的数据块,进行更多的I/O操作和CPU计算。只选择需要的列,避免查询不必要的列。
此外,MySQL表的列数还会影响数据的存取速度。当表的列数很多时,MySQL需要更多的时间来读取和写入数据,从而影响了数据的存取速度。这会导致系统的响应速度变慢,用户体验也会受到影响。只选择需要的列,避免存取不必要的列。
综上所述,MySQL表的列数对数据库的性能有着不可忽视的影响。尽量减少不必要的列,避免浪费磁盘空间,避免查询不必要的列,避免存取不必要的列。这样可以提高系统的响应速度和处理能力,提高用户体验。
如果觉得《mysql列数对性能的影响有多大? 手机mysql链接》对你有帮助,请点赞、收藏,并留下你的观点哦!